It may have taken overtime to finish the job, but Herrin ultimately got the result they hoped for on Tuesday. They snuck past the Massac County Patriots with a 76-70 win. Given the Tigers' advantage in MaxPreps' Illinois basketball rankings (they are ranked 97th, while the Patriots are ranked 322nd),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.

Leading Herrin to victory were Kyrese Lukens and Grady Cox. Lukens went 8 of 14 to rack up 29 points and five rebounds, while Cox dropped a double-double with 22 points and 14 boards. Thanks to that strong game, Lukens now owns an excellent 45.4% shooting accuracy. The team also got some help courtesy of Jared Staple Jr., who posted nine points.

Herrin sm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 13 offensive boards. The team's really been improving in that area: they've now improved their offensive rebound total in four consecutive contests.

Despite the loss, Massac County had strong showings from Jack Turner, who went 8 for 19 on his way to 28 points, and Jude Harmon, who went 8 of 15 en route to 21 points. That was a full 40% of Massac County's points, marking the third time in a row he's had more than a third of the team's points.

Herrin is on a roll lately: they've won nine of their last 12 matchups, which somehow still isn't as good as their 22-6 record this season. As for Massac County,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 11-15.

Both squads are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Herrin will face off against Mascoutah at 1:00 p.m. on Saturday. As for Massac County, they will square off against Carterville at 6:00 p.m. on Friday. Carterville will roll in looking for their fourth straight victory, something Massac County surely won't give up without a fight.
